MapsBandar Springhill in Port Dickson, Negeri Sembilan recorded 3 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, sized between 2,125 and 2,174 sqft, with a median price of RM 430K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M 199.
This area contains both residential and commercial properties. View 379 residential properties or 16 commercial properties separately for more focused analysis.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M 430K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M 390K to RM 537K, and a typical market range of RM 390K to RM 531K.
Most transactions involved 2 - 2 1/2 storey terraced, with moderate diversity in property types available.
Price per square foot shows a median of RM 199, though individual units vary from RM 148 to RM 249 in the core range. The broader market spans RM 144.00 to RM 253.50, indicating diverse property characteristics. A wider spread (IQR: RM 109.50) and deviation (MAD: RM 50) indicate significant PSF variations, likely due to diverse property types or conditions.
